• POLICY Hl <br />1/12/05 <br />ITEM: Consideration of Ordinance 05-01 regarding bus bench signs <br />(continued from the December 8, 2004 Council meeting) <br />SUBMITTED BY: Heather Worthington, City Administrator <br />REVIEWED BY: Roger Knutson, City Attorney <br />EXPLANATION: <br />Summary: In early April, staff notified U.S. Bench that they were in violation of a City <br />ordinance which prohibits advertising signs in the right of way. This enforcement action was <br />the result of a citizen complaint about the location of a bus bench adjacent to the resident's <br />property. At the May 5, 2004 meeting, the Council enacted a six month moratorium on the <br />installation of any new bus bench signs in the City to give staff time to research the issue and <br />come back to the Council with a recommendation. <br />At the September 22°d meeting, staff requested extension of this moratorium to November 24th. <br />At the November 24th meeting, the City Council reviewed staff recommendations for an <br />• ordinance concerning bus bench or courtesy bench signs. Staff brought a final ordinance back <br />to the Council for review and consideration at the December 8, 2004 Council meeting and the <br />Council decided to continue the matter to the January 12, 2005 meeting to allow time for Council <br />review. <br />At the December 8, 2004 meeting, the Council decided to lay this matter over to the January 12, <br />2005 meeting.
